Buying Mission

Definition

Buying mission is a promotion form which facilitate future investors/buyers who visit Indonesia in order to conduct transaction or investment that will increase Indonesia's export value. In 2014, Buying Mission targeted 10 countries with 100 buyers. There are five traditional countries and five non traditional with transaction target of $120 million USD.


Future Buyer Qualifications

- Foreign importer/distributor/wholesaler/retailer/trading company;

- Foreign company mentioned should have conducted intensive communication with Indonesian exporter and/or Indonesian Representatives/Trade Attaché/ITPC/KDEI Taipei therefore ready to sign MoU, contract/purchasing order;

- Buyers who attend are decision makers that will determine the business contract; Future facilitated buyers should be approved by Indonesia Representatives/Trade Attaché/ITPC/KDEI Taipei.


Future Buyer Criteria

- Buyer with recommendation from Indonesia Representatives/Trade Attaché/ITPC/KDEI Taipei;

- Able to fulfill minimum requirement order and estimated volume;

- Listed as importer in commerce chamber, association, or business entity in origin country.

Exporters Qualifications

- Company has conducted export;

- Company must have complete documents and export procedures namely Press Publication Business License (SIUPP), Tax Identification Number (NPWP), Corporate Registry (TDP), Single Identity Number (NIK), and Declaration of Exportations of Goods (PEB);

- Company should provide production capacity as requested by buyer;

- Company has to have long-term export plan;

- Company focuses on 10 main product and 10 prospective product, and opens to other products as well;

- A waiver that the company is currently not involved in legal issues.

Facilities Provided by DGNED for Buyers

- Round-trip airplane fare reimbursement, including travel insurance, with a maximum of $3,000 USD for 1 (one) buyer from 1 (one) company with travel route: origin country - Indonesia (Jakarta/Province) - origin country;

- Tickets for maximum 3 (three) provinces to visit companies/production centers;

- Four-star hotel accommodation for maximum 5 days and 4 nights;

- Accommodation for local transportations;

- Three meals during the activities;

- Translator for non english speaking buyer;

- Assistant from DGNED team during visits to provinces;

- Travel and accommodation expenses for the assistant from Indonesia Representatives outside the country/Trade Attaché/ITPC/KDEI Taipei will be paid by Indonesia Representatives/Trade Attaché/ITPC/KDEI Taipei.

Buyer’s Appreciation

Definition

Buyer's Appreciation is a monitoring program and partnership implementation that develops national exports by giving rewards for buyers who have good networks with Indonesian exporters proven by lists of import transactions with stakeholders. Judges for Buyer's Appreciation are stakeholders with related professional factors (governments, practitioners, economists, academics, journalists, KADIN, associations, etc.). Proposed judges names are delivered to DGNED for approval from up to minister (if needed).

Buyer Qualifications

Qualified buyers are foreign importer/distributor/wholesaler/retailer/trading companies:

- The company should be selected according the criteria (has an increasing trend related to import value performance in the last 3 (three) years and is included in the product classification and/or Indonesia export market) and chosen by the implementation team, Indonesia Representatives/Trade Attaché/ITPC/KDEI Taipei, and judges, to be sent to Indonesia in order to participate in Buyer's Appreciation event.

- Buyer who wins the appreciation is the buyer with the biggest contribution in increasing Indonesia's export, attached with a copy of the buyer's export contract with Indonesia;

- The company must be legally listed by the origin country;

- Company categorized as large companies and medium-sized company;

- During registration, company can provide its import realization overview and projection from Indonesia for the next 3 years.

- Facilitated buyer should be verified by Indonesia Representatives/Trade Attaché/ITPC/KDEI Taipei.

Facilities Given to Buyers

- Round-trip airplane fare reimbursement, including travel insurance, with a maximum of $3,000 USD for 1 (one) buyer from 1 (one) company with travel route: origin country - Indonesia (Jakarta/Province) - origin country;

- Four-star hotel accommodation for maximum 3 days and 2 nights;

- Accommodation for local transportation;

- Travel and accommodation expenses for the assistant from Indonesia Representatives outside the country/Trade Attaché/ITPC/KDEI Taipei and best buyer will be paid by Indonesia Representatives/Trade Attaché/ITPC/KDEI Taipei in TEI 2014 event.
